Abstract:
An internal combustion engine is described in conjunction with a method for dynamically determining a mass flow rate of nitrogen oxides (NOx) for its exhaust gas feedstream. The method includes determining a present engine operating point and determining a reference NOx content for a reference engine operating point. A combustion chemical reaction rate is determined based upon the present engine operating point and the reference engine operating point. A NOx content in the exhaust gas feedstream is dynamically determined during operation of the internal combustion engine based upon the reference NOx content, the combustion chemical reaction rate and a combustion mixing rate constant.
